Hotwire.com®, a leading discount travel site, today announced further results from their American Travel Behavior Survey, conducted on their behalf online by Harris Interactive in July 2011 among over 2,000 adults. The survey revealed that 41 percent of U.S. adults who travel spend the majority of their vacation budget on obligation trips such as reunions, weddings, holiday gatherings, etc. However, most (89%) would love to take more leisure trips, if they had the time and money, but struggle to figure out how to fit them in.

Kayak is boosting its hotel search today with the integration of hotel reviews from TripAdvisor into search results. Via an agreement with the reviews giant, Kayak will be integrating all all TripAdvisor reviews into the Kayak Hotel Search. Simply put, when you search for a hotel on Kayak, all of the over 60 million TripAdvisor reviews will be included in the KAYAK search results.

Travelers are generally pleased with the customer service they're getting from online travel agencies, according to a customer satisfaction survey released Tuesday. Online travel agencies' customer satisfaction score totaled 78, unchanged from a year ago, says the American Customer Satisfaction Index's annual e-Commerce report. Any score around 80 is considered solid, says Larry Freed, author of the report and CEO of consulting firm ForeSee.
